Block 629296

ed4fa11e64fa7e6d8e5ef3a18fbfe769459e80047898feacad8dabf9c5180f6b
Transactions1
Height629296
Confirmations4974795
TimestampWed, 18 Mar 2015 15:49:59 UTC
Size (bytes)201
Version2
Merkle Root294d1b60b9774162d77b934a9141d7a08a59279b787cd5bc609107e21a3b3147
Nonce3254792448
Bits1c25af0f
Difficulty6.793262356927934

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4974795 Confirmations80 FTC